Nigerian singer Damini Ebunoluwa Ogulu, professionally known as Burna Boy, has clinched two accolades at the MOBO Awards 2022 which took place at the Wembley Arena.

The record producer won two awards in the ‘Best International Act’ and ‘Best African Music Act’ categories.
MOBO Awards (Music Of Black Origin, also referred to as MOBOs) is a yearly British Music Awards presentation to honour achievements in “music of black origin”, which encompasses hip hop, reggae, R&B, African music and so on.
Burna Boy got nominated in the ‘Best International Act’ category alongside top American artists like Beyonce, Drake, Chris Brown, others on the category are Nigerian female songwriter and singer, Temilade Openiyi, known popularly by her stage name, Tems, Jack Harlow, Jazmine Sullivan, Kendrick Lamar, Skillibeng, Summer Walker.
